sql >> Base de Datos >  >> RDS >> Oracle

Secuencia de Oracle que comienza con 2 en lugar de 1

Esto está documentado en la referencia del lenguaje SQL 11.2 donde dice,

Si intenta insertar un valor de secuencia en una tabla que utiliza la creación de segmentos diferidos, se omitirá el primer valor que devuelva la secuencia.

Consulte el enlace en la respuesta de Jeffrey Kemp para obtener una nota de My Oracle Support (Metalink) y una solución alternativa.